PM, Sonia wish Karunanidhi speedy recovery Chennai | Saturday, May 17 2008 IST
Prime Minister Manmohan Singh and Congress President Sonia Gandhi today enquired about the health of Tamil Nadu Chief Minister and DMK President M Karunanidhi, who is undergoing treatment for neck and back pain in a private hospital at suburban Porur. An official release here said Dr Singh sent a bouquet of flowers wishing Mr Karunanidhi speedy recovery. Ms Gandhi spoke to Mr Karunanidhi's daughter and Rajya Sabha member Kanimozhi by telephone and enquired about his health. Tamil Nadu Governor S S Barnala spoke to the 84-year-old Dravidian patriarch and enquired about his health condition. He also sent a bouquet to him. Meanwhile, Mr Karunanidhi's Madurai-based son M K Azhagiri, former Union Minister Dayanidhi Maran, Congress leader K V Thangabalu and 'Vanniya Peravai' leader Jagathratchagan called on the Chief Minister and enquired about his health condition. Mr Karunanidhi was admitted to the hospital yesterday as he was advised rest. Doctors attending on him also suggested physiotheraphy for speedy recovery. -- (UNI) -- 17MS39.xml
